Output 0840e63d2633303bdde68fd35ac9ba0899cac972ad2e66f0c529f64e4fbd8faf:0

value
33063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c88b9f33576e9e77a07147ba261335d5003285a OP_EQUAL
address
3BathBAGWzxEUgUR7RZPuAVMm2GRghkJCN
transaction
0840e63d2633303bdde68fd35ac9ba0899cac972ad2e66f0c529f64e4fbd8faf
spent
true